Diagrammatic highway signs : the laboratory revisited. Paper prepared for the 55th Annual Meeting of the Transportation Research Board TRB, Washington, D.C., January 1976.

Abstract

The experiment summarized in this paper was designed to establish a low cost reliable laboratory technique for the evaluation of highway guide signs and to resolve differences in previous laboratory studies with regard to diagrammatic guide signs. These two objectives were accomplished. The base findings of two earlier studies reported in Highway Research Record No. 414 (See B 2463) were replicated, indicating a high reliability of the data.
